Three Salvadoran military officers have been accused of carrying out the abductions of prominent businessmen between 1982 and 1986. Two men arrested in connection with two right-wing kidnaping rings told a military judge that Col. Roberto Mauricio Staben, Col. Joaquin Zacapa and Maj. Jose Alfredo Jimenez were involved in at least five abductions. Staben, who has since been removed as commander of the elite, U.S.-trained Arce battalion, and Jimenez are being held in San Salvador. Zacapa left the country before he was implicated in the kidnapings and has not returned. None of the men has been formally charged.
